Page MenuHomePhabricator

rebuildall.php maintenance script adds RC log entries (e.g. "Patrol Log") that would not normally be there
Open, LowPublic

Description

I ran the rebuildall.php script from the command line. When it rebuilt the recent changes table, it created several "log" entries for actions that would not normally show in recent changes.

For example, it added several "Patrol Log" entries, which are normally suppressed. In addition, my wiki has two custom logs that I use, and do NOT normally show on RC. These entries also showed in RC after I ran rebuildall.php


Version: 1.20.x
Severity: minor
See Also:
https://bugzilla.wikimedia.org/show_bug.cgi?id=18364

Details

Reference
bz47789

Event Timeline

bzimport raised the priority of this task from to Low.Nov 22 2014, 1:17 AM
bzimport set Reference to bz47789.
bzimport added a subscriber: Unknown Object (MLST).

Ok, so it looks like the real culprit is rebuildrecentchanges.php, which is called from rebuildall.php. Bug #18364 mentions this in the comments. Should we close this, or merge it in?

Brad: Not sure exactly what you mean by "Should we close this, or merge it in?"
Could you elaborate?

We have two bugs that are tracking this same issue, although the other bug only mentions it in the comments. Should we merge the two reports?